MANILA, Philippines — Public Works and Highways Secretary Vince Dizon said they would revisit the budget of the agency and vowed to complete the revision within two weeks.
“We will follow the directive of our President. And for how this will be done, I think we will be guided by our Secretary of the Department of Budget and Management,” Dizon told reporters during a briefing late Wednesday.

President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. on Wednesday directed both departments to conduct a "sweeping review" of the DPWH proposed budget under the 2026 National Expenditure Program (NEP).
